The morphological ontogeny of Carinogalumna erciyesi sp. nov. from Turkey is described and illustrated. The adult of this species is most similar to that of C. montana Engelbrecht, 1973 but differs from it mainly by the shape of the bothridial seta and porose areas Aa and A2. The larva of C. erciyesi has 12 pairs of gastronotal setae, including alveolar h3, nymphs have 15 pairs; most setae are of medium size and barbed, except for short p2 and p3, smooth in protonymph; setae p2 and p3 are inserted on unsclerotized integument. In all juveniles the bothridial seta is clavate with long, narrow, barbed head. The gastronotal shield is well-developed with setae of d-, l-series and h1 in the larva, and of d-, l-, h-series and p1 in the nymphs. Setae of c-series of juveniles are inserted on microsclerites, and genital opening is placed on a large sclerite. In all juveniles a humeral organ is present, with porose area above it.

The morphological ontogeny of Nanhermannia sellnicki Forsslund, 1958 is described and illustrated. In all juvenile stages the bothridial seta is minute, and two pairs of exobothridial setae are present (exa reduced to its alveolus, exp short). In the larva, the seta f1 is setiform but in the nymphs it is unobservable among cuticular tubercles. Most prodorsal and gastronotal setae of the larva are short while thouse of nymphs are long; seta in and all gastronotal and adanal setae are inserted in small individual depressions. In all instars the leg segments are oval in cross section and relatively thick, and most setae on tarsi are relatively short, thick or conical. The seta d accompanies solenidion on all genua, 1 on tibia I and on other tibiae.

The morphological ontogeny of Oribatula heterochaeta (Feider et al., 1970) is described and illustrated. The larva of this species has 12 pairs of gastronotal setae including h3 and the nymphs have 15 pairs; most are of medium size and barbed except for short and smooth h3 in the larva and p3 in the protonymph and deutonymph. In the larva, the excentrosclerites are present at four pairs of gastronotal setae (c2, la, lp, h1), and in the nymphs at seven pairs (c2, la, lp, h-series, p1). Comparisons of known morphological ontogeny of species in Oribatula are given.

The morphological ontogeny of Zachvatkinibates svanhovdi A. Seniczak & S. Seniczak, 2023 is described and illustrated. The juveniles of this species are light brown with slightly darker colour on the prodorsum, gastronotal shield, surrounding of gla opening, and legs. The larva has 12 pairs of gastronotal setae, most are of medium size and barbed; the nymphs have 15 pairs, most are short and smooth. In all juveniles, the setae of c-series are inserted on unsclerotized integument. In the larva, the pygidial shield is absent but, in the nymphs, the gastronotal shield is present and the setae p2 and p3 are inserted on unsclerotized integument. In the larva, a humeral organ is absent but is present in the nymphs.

The morphological ontogeny of Ceratozetes parvulus Sellnick, 1922 is described and illustrated. Some aspects of its ecology are also investigated. The juveniles of this species have short prodorsal and gastronotal setae, tubercles and transverse folds on the gastronotum and setiform bothridial seta. Most leg setae are short, thick and strongly reduced (lack of setae l on femur III of deutonymph and tritonymph, pl on tarsus I, it on all tarsi, and pv on tarsus IV of nymphs), which are unique in Ceratozetes Berlese, 1908. This species is common in peatlands, where it seems to prefer specifically drier microhabitats, like hummocks.

Morphological ontogeny of Oribatella similesuperbula Weigmann, 2001 based on specimens from Romania, is described and illustrated. The nymphs of this species are apopheredermous, i.e. they carry the exuvial scalps of previous instars away from the dorsal integument, using modified setal pair da. The prodorsal and most gastronotal setae of juveniles are long and barbed, except for medium sized h2 and minute h3 in the larva, and medium sized c1, p2 and p3 in the nymphs. The larva has 12 pairs of gastronotal setae, the nymphs have 15 pairs. In all juveniles, a humeral organ is present.

The morphological ontogeny of Perlohmannia nasuta Schuster, 1958 is described and illustrated. The adult of this species is the most similar to that of P. dissimilis (Hewitt, 1908), but differs from it by having alveolar seta exp (versus setiform in P. dissimilis), which is unique in Perlohmannia Berlese, 1916. It also has more spines on the bothridial seta and shorter seta c1 than has P. dissimilis. The juveniles of P. nasuta have the prodorsal seta exp alveolar, 78 anterior spines on the bothridial seta, and seta e2 longer than f2. Clapardes organ of larva is long and cudgel-shaped. This species differs clearly from P. dissimilis in the ontogeny of leg setae. In both species, hypertrichy occurs on tarsi, especially on tarsus I, but P. nasuta has more setae on tarsus I of deutonymph, tritonymph and adult than has P. dissimilis.
